Embodiment 1
[0027] Embodiment 1: Its preparation method of a kind of high weather resistance exterior wall nano-coating is as follows,
[0028] Step 1, solution A, dissolve 6 parts of polyvinylpyrrolidone in 20 parts of absolute ethanol and stir for 20 minutes; solution B, add 6 parts of stannous chloride to 20 parts of N~N dimethyl formaldehyde under stirring condition In amide, stir thoroughly for 20 minutes;
[0029] Step 2, mix A solution and B solution in a ratio of 1:1, add 1 part of acetylacetone, 5 parts of carbon quantum dots and 2 parts of mineral oil, and fully stir for 12 hours to obtain a precursor colloidal solution for preparing mesoporous tin dioxide;
[0030] Step 3, put the precursor solution prepared in step 2 into a spinneret with an inner diameter of 0.4mm, the receiving device is an aluminum roller with a grounded rotation diameter of 100mm, the receiving distance is 18cm, the spinning voltage is 15kV, and electrospinning is carried out ;
